Output 8c4bb3d34034259fb84112ebc9867f34db432ec5db7cf9eaf1488768156e6161:13

value
345749
script pubkey
OP_0 OP_PUSHBYTES_20 95cfd22eed939cabbe991e9500fc98bbfd43d18e
address
bc1qjh8aythdjww2h05er62splych07585vw2rrrht
transaction
8c4bb3d34034259fb84112ebc9867f34db432ec5db7cf9eaf1488768156e6161
spent
true